During a recent Special City Council Meeting in Plainfield, urgent discussions centered on the critical state of the local health center, which serves thousands of residents. Council members expressed deep concern over the potential consequences of inadequate support for this essential service, with one member emphasizing that failing to act could lead to dire outcomes for the community.
The council highlighted the need for immediate improvements and protective measures for the health center, which many residents depend on for their well-being. The urgency of the situation was palpable, as officials acknowledged that without proper intervention, the health center's ability to serve the community could be severely compromised.
